Spanish Weather Report video
Spanish Honors Weather Report video
Write and record a weather report from a Spanish speaking country. You must include: channel name, where you are reporting from, current weather, temperature, and suggestions for clothing. Include today's weather and what the weather will be the whole week. Use graph as a way to talk about the weather temperature/condition for the week.
